How Gantt Charts Visually Show Resource Assignments: Guide

Resource assignments in a Gantt chart are shown as tasks placed on a timeline, with each task linked to the person, team, equipment, or capacity assigned to complete it. The chart may use names, initials, colors, labels, or grouped swimlanes to make ownership visible.

Without that visual link, a schedule can look healthy while one specialist handles six urgent tasks at once. Deadlines slip, work clashes, and managers discover capacity problems only after the plan starts.

How Resource Assignments Appear in a Gantt Chart

A Gantt chart usually shows resource assignments through a combination of timeline bars, labels, colors, and grouped task rows. Each bar represents a task, while the attached name or marker shows who is responsible for it.

For example, a design task might appear as a blue bar labeled “Maya,” stretching from June 3 to June 7. A testing task below it might carry a green label for “QA Team,” beginning after the design work ends.

How to Read Assignments Step by Step

  1. Start with the task list. Read the activity names before examining the timeline. You need to understand what each bar represents.
  2. Find the assigned resource. Look beside the task name, inside the bar, or in the resource column for the responsible person or team.
  3. Check the date range. Compare the bar’s start and finish dates with the person’s other assignments.
  4. Look for overlaps. Two or more bars on the same dates may indicate parallel work or a possible capacity conflict.
  5. Review effort separately from duration. A task lasting five days may require only ten hours of work. Duration alone does not prove overassignment.
  6. Follow dependencies. Check whether one person must finish work before another person can begin.
  7. Compare planned capacity. Assess the assignment against working hours, leave, meetings, and other commitments.
  8. Adjust the schedule. Move dates, redistribute tasks, add support, or change the sequence when the visual reveals an unrealistic plan.

Imagine that Jordan owns requirements analysis from Monday through Wednesday and user testing from Tuesday through Friday. The overlapping bars may be acceptable if the testing work needs only a few hours each day.

However, if both activities require Jordan’s full attention, the chart is showing a scheduling problem. You could shift testing, assign another tester, or split the analysis into smaller activities.

Common Ways Tools Display Ownership

Project teams use several visual patterns to show responsibility. Each pattern answers the same question: who is expected to complete this work?

Labels Inside or Beside Task Bars

The simplest method places a name, role, or team label next to the task. This works well when the chart contains a small number of assignments.

For example, “API review — Priya” immediately connects the activity with its owner. If the label disappears on a narrow screen, you may need to open the task details.

Color-Coded Assignments

Colors help you scan a busy timeline quickly. Blue might represent engineering, orange could represent marketing, and purple might represent external review.

Color alone should not carry the full meaning. Add names or role labels because color perception varies, and similar shades can become difficult to distinguish.

Resource Grouping

Some Gantt views place each person or team in a separate group. Their assigned activities appear as bars beneath their name.

This layout makes workload distribution easier to compare. If one engineer has twelve bars and another has two, the imbalance becomes visible without opening every task.

Swimlanes and Separate Resource Rows

Swimlanes divide the schedule into horizontal sections. Each lane can represent a department, role, location, or delivery team.

A product launch might use lanes for product, engineering, legal, sales, and support. Cross-team handoffs then become easier to trace across the timeline.

Icons, Initials, and Avatars

Compact charts often use profile images or initials to conserve space. Hovering over the marker may reveal the full name, role, and assignment details.

This method suits dashboards, although it can become unclear when several people share similar initials. Consistent naming helps prevent confusion.

What Overlapping Assignments Tell You

Overlapping bars are not automatically a problem. They show that a person or team has work scheduled during the same period.

For example, a project manager may review risks while coordinating a vendor meeting. Those activities overlap, yet neither may require a full day.

Let me explain: a Gantt chart shows planned timing, while capacity planning tests whether that timing is realistic. You need both views before approving the schedule.

A useful review compares assigned effort with available capacity. If a developer has 32 workable hours and receives assignments totaling 44 hours, the chart should trigger a conversation.

How to Spot Overallocated Resources

Overallocation happens when assigned work exceeds a person’s or team’s practical capacity during a period.

Many tools flag this condition with red bars, warning icons, shading, or a utilization percentage. Some show a separate workload panel beside the schedule.

A Practical Review Method

  1. Choose one person or team.
  2. Filter the chart to that resource’s assignments.
  3. Review all overlapping tasks for the same dates.
  4. Estimate the effort required by each task.
  5. Subtract meetings, leave, support duties, and other planned commitments.
  6. Decide whether to delay, delegate, reduce, or sequence the work.

Consider a content specialist with 40 available hours in one week. Three assignments require 16, 14, and 12 hours, creating 42 hours before meetings or revisions.

The visual overlap is useful, but the effort total reveals the real issue. A two-day bar does not always equal sixteen hours, so task estimates must support the chart.

How to Improve the Visual Clarity of Assignments

A chart becomes more useful when every visual element has a consistent meaning. Start by defining naming, color, and grouping rules for your project team.

Use Clear Assignment Labels

Use a person’s name for individual accountability and a team name when the work belongs to a shared queue. Avoid vague labels such as “team” or “development” when one person actually owns the next action.

Separate Responsibility from Participation

A task may involve several contributors, but one accountable owner should remain visible. List supporting contributors in the task details or a secondary field.

For example, “Release checklist — Elena” can include engineering and support contributors without making ownership unclear.

Apply a Small Color System

Use colors for one purpose at a time. If blue means engineering in one view and high priority in another, the chart becomes difficult to interpret.

A practical system might use department colors and a separate icon for risk. That keeps ownership distinct from status.

Break Large Assignments Into Real Work

A bar called “Build platform” may last six weeks and hide several owners. Split it into planning, implementation, review, testing, and release activities.

Smaller tasks reveal handoffs and make assignment conflicts easier to identify.

Common Challenges and Practical Fixes

Challenge: The Chart Shows Names but Not Capacity

Why it happens: Assignment labels identify ownership, yet they do not reveal available hours or effort.

Practical fix: Add estimates, working calendars, leave periods, and workload indicators. Review hours alongside timeline dates.

Challenge: Color Coding Becomes Confusing

Why it happens: Teams assign colors to multiple meanings, such as department, priority, and status.

Practical fix: Give each color system one job. Use labels, icons, or filters for additional information.

Challenge: Shared Team Assignments Hide Individual Accountability

Why it happens: A group label looks efficient, but nobody knows who owns the next action.

Practical fix: Assign one accountable person and list other contributors separately.

Challenge: Large Summary Bars Conceal Workload Problems

Why it happens: A long activity combines planning, execution, review, and delivery under one owner.

Practical fix: Divide the activity into meaningful stages. Add handoffs and dependencies between them.

Challenge: The Schedule Is Updated Too Infrequently

Why it happens: A chart can become inaccurate when assignments change in meetings, messages, or informal conversations.

Practical fix: Establish a regular update routine. Ask owners to confirm dates, effort, blockers, and remaining work during each review.

FAQs

What does a bar represent in a resource-loaded Gantt chart?

A bar normally represents one scheduled task. Its horizontal position shows timing, while its length shows planned duration.

A label, color, icon, or grouped row identifies the assigned person or team. Some tools also display progress, effort, status, and dependencies beside the bar.

Can one task have multiple resource assignments?

Yes. A task may involve several people, such as a developer, designer, and reviewer. However, showing several contributors can make accountability unclear.

Keep one primary owner visible, then identify supporting contributors through additional assignment fields or task details.

Does an overlapping bar always mean someone is overallocated?

No. Overlap only proves that assignments occur during the same period. The person may have enough capacity if one task requires limited effort or happens intermittently.

Confirm the estimated hours, working calendar, deadlines, and concentration requirements before changing the plan.

What is the difference between task duration and resource effort?

Duration measures the calendar period between a task’s start and finish. Effort measures the amount of work required from the assigned resource.

A five-day task might require ten hours spread across the week. Another five-day task could require forty hours, so the two assignments affect capacity very differently.

How should I show team-owned work?

Use a team label when the work genuinely belongs to a shared queue. Then assign a responsible coordinator or next action owner.

For example, “Security review — Security Team” can include “Owner: Marcus.” This preserves the shared responsibility while keeping follow-up clear.

Which Gantt view is best for checking workload?

A resource-grouped view is usually easiest for comparing assignments across people or teams. A task-grouped view works better for following project sequence and dependencies.

Use both when possible. The first reveals capacity patterns, while the second explains how work moves through the project.

Conclusion

Gantt charts show resource assignments by connecting timeline bars with names, roles, teams, colors, icons, or grouped resource rows. The clearest charts make ownership, timing, effort, and dependencies visible together.

Start by finding the assigned resource, checking the date range, examining overlaps, and comparing effort with practical capacity. Then improve clarity with consistent labels, restrained color coding, accountable owners, and smaller work packages.
